HPLC, often called high-strain liquid chromatography, is actually a chromatographic method that utilizes a liquid cell phase to independent different substances in a sample. It is based about the principle of differential partitioning of analytes among a stationary phase along with a cellular section.

In HPLC Evaluation, a variety of substances even in moment quantities like in nano-grams or pictograms may be calculated in a speedier fee.

[forty three] The definition of peak ability in chromatography is the quantity of peaks that could be separated within a retention window for a selected pre-described resolution component, commonly ~1. It could also be envisioned given that the runtime measured in quantity of peaks' typical widths. The equation is shown during the Figure from the performance standards. In this particular equation tg would be the gradient time and w(ave) is the average peaks width at the base.

Chromatographic Column: The column will be the separation chamber wherever the sample factors interact with the stationary stage. It is often a lengthy, slim tube full of smaller, porous particles coated using a stationary phase substance.

Solute ions charged the same as the ions to the column are repulsed and elute with out retention, even though solute ions charged oppositely to your billed web-sites on the column are retained on it. Solute ions which are retained over the column might be click here eluted from it by switching the cell section composition, which include escalating its salt concentration and pH or raising the column temperature, etc.

In isocratic elution, peak width raises with retention time linearly in accordance with the equation for N, the quantity of theoretical plates. This can be An important drawback when examining a sample that contains analytes with a variety of retention components. Using a weaker cellular phase, the runtime is lengthened and ends in little by little eluting peaks to become wide, bringing about lessened sensitivity.
